COMPANY BACKGROUND

Epiq Solutions develops cutting-edge software-defined radio (SDR) products and processing solutions to enable spectrum dominance for maritime, land, air, and space domains. With 15 years serving government and commercial enterprise customers and 25K+ devices fielded to date, Epiq Solutions is a trusted partner with a proven heritage of delivering open architecture products in radically small form factors where time-to-market, cost, and performance are critical for mission success.

JOB R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Develop block diagrams of potential hardware design concepts from high level requirements.
  • Lead the RF/Microwave circuit and sub-system design, component analysis, modeling, simulation, prototyping and integration.
  • Perform part selection and schematic entry for analog/RF/digital circuit designs
  • Lead circuit design through layout by providing guidance on parts placement and critical routing
  • Troubleshoot prototype and production hardware in the lab using RF, analog, and digital test equipment
  • Assist with the creation and review of technical documentation and proposals
  • Collaborate with a cross-functional teams such as Software, FPGA, Automated Test, Production to enable feature implementation, integration & debugging to develop new SDR products.
  • Drive best practices on the team, deal with ambiguity and competing objectives, and proactively identify and mitigate risks before they become roadblocks.

REQUIRED SKILLS

  • Bachelor's or higher in electrical or computer engineering, or equivalent experience.
  • Minimum of 8 years of prior work experience developing real-world products.
  • Able to work both independently and as part of a cross-domain engineering team.
  • Design experience with at least three of the following:

- RF low noise amplifiers (LNA)

- RF power amplifiers (PA)

- RF frequency synthesizer analysis/design (PLLs)

- RF impedance matching (Smith charts)

- RF filter design (lumped element and/or distributed)

- Switching power supplies (DC/DC converters)

- Embedded microcontrollers and associated interfacing (I2C, SPI, UART)

- High speed digital design including FPGA-based systems

- Interfacing to high-speed A/D and D/A converters

  • Experience with at least one schematic capture/PCB layout package (Altium Designer preferred)
  • Experience with microwave test equipment such as vector network analyzers, power meters, oscilloscopes, spectrum analyzers, noise sources, multimeter, and signal sources
